Convenciones de nombres en Kotlin: Resumen de la guía oficial
4 min de lectura
Kotlin sigue convenciones similares a Java, con algunas adiciones específicas de Kotlin.
Tabla de convenciones
| Elemento | Convención | Ejemplo |
|---|---|---|
| Propiedades | camelCase | userName |
| Funciones | camelCase | getUserById() |
| Clases | PascalCase | UserAccount |
| Objetos/Singletons | PascalCase | DatabaseConfig |
| Constantes (nivel superior) | SCREAMING_SNAKE | MAX_COUNT |
| Paquetes | Minúsculas, puntos | com.example.app |
| Propiedades de respaldo | Prefijo _ | _items |